In a bid to improve working conditions for people who deliver food and offer rides through smartphone apps, the European Union gave provisional approval Wednesday to rules that determine who should get the benefits of full-time employees and restrict the way online platforms use algorithms to manage their workers. The European Parliament and the EU's 27 member countries agreed on a platform worker directive that has been years in the making. It aims to boost protections and benefits for the growing number of gig economy workers, while raising accountability and transparency for apps tha...
Under the new law, many platform workers in Europe could be reclassified as employees and therefore gain access to labour and social protection rights, the parliament said.

SINGAPORE: From Jan 15 next year, eligible platform workers who get injured at work can apply for S$250 (US$186.50) of FairPrice vouchers to help them while they await more aid from other relief schemes, said the National Trades Union Congress (NTUC) on Wednesday (Dec 6).
